Dr. Rita Boggs, CEO of American
Research and Testing Inc., founded the company in 1982.
EDUCATION
-
Cornell University - Postdoctoral Research
Associate, 1973-1975
-
University of Pennsylvania - Ph.D.
Physical Chemistry, 1973
-
Union College - M.S. Chemistry, 1967
-
Notre Dame College of Staten Island - B.A.
Chemistry (cum laude, 1959)
EXPERIENCE
-
2008-present: CEO, American Research
and Testing, Inc.
-
1982-2008: President, American Research
and Testing, Inc.
-
1985-1987,1993-Present: Adjunct Professor,
Chemistry - California State University, Dominguez Hills
-
1983-1985: Adjunct Professor, Chemistry -
El Camino College, Torrance, Ca.
-
1979-1982: Assistant Vice President, California
Division, United States Testing Co. -Director of Chemistry and Textiles
Groups
-
1975-1979: Senior Research Chemist, Colgate
Palmolive Research Center, Piscataway, N.J. - New Science (Basic Research)
- Oral Research; Detergents
-
1977-1978: Adjunct Assistant Professor,Chemistry
- Rutgers University,University College, New Brunswick,N.J.- Inorganic
Chemistry, Analytical Spectroscopy
-
1967-1969: Instructor - Notre Dame College,
Staten Island, N.Y. - Physical Chemistry, Analytical Chemistry, Physics
-
1961-1967: Teacher - Notre Dame High School,
Schenectady, N.Y.- Chemistry, Physics
